TITLE: Proposal Drafter
EXEMPT STATUS: Non-Exempt
SUMMARY: Responsible for producing proposal drawings in support of the Sales department during the Proposal stage of new projects. He/She is also responsible to produce fabrication detail drawings based on the engineering design that conforms with engineering standards, specifications, ASME Code requirements, material availability, and shop practices. Utilize computer-aided design/drafting tools and techniques to perform all drafting and design requirements.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
- Prepare proposal drawings using application engineers input and references.
- Work with Sales team members to ensure drawings meet all design requirements.
- Work with a project team to enable efficient, effective and successful project execution..
- Prepare shop detail drawings based on the engineering design.
- Prepare Bill of Material's as required to complete detail drawings.
- Participate in developing new procedures and standards in the Drafting Group.
TECHNICAL SKILLS:
- Strong analytical skills to perform essential job functions.
- Good communication skills.
- General understanding of boiler systems;
- Knowledge of structural steel detailing from drafting perspective.
- Basic knowledge of production welding practices.
- Strong CAD (AutoCAD (2019 preferred), 2D or 3D) skills and abilities.
- Technical software skills to keep accurate and easily accessible records; MS Suite familiarity.
